A leading healthcare provider in the UK seeks a Fetal Wellbeing Specialist to lead programs enhancing fetal wellbeing knowledge among midwives and obstetricians. The ideal candidate will demonstrate clinical expertise and act as a role model within our maternity team, addressing learning needs through tailored action plans.

Responsibilities include:

  • Facilitating competency assessments
  • Ensuring all staff provide high-quality antenatal care

This role is crucial in improving clinical decision making and patient care standards.
